Background Check Errors in Fullerton, CA – Your Rights and Recourse
Experiencing a inaccuracy on a background history in Fullerton, California? These can be incredibly stressful, potentially impacting employment opportunities, rental applications, and other aspects of your life. Being aware of the rights and available options is essential. Pursuant to state law, you have the right to dispute erroneous information. Applicants can start the dispute review directly with credit bureau, such as Equifax or an smaller, specialized screening company. In case reporting bureau neglects to correct data, applicants may need to explore expert guidance or file a appeal with the Department of Fair Employment.
